Who can apply
- Applicants must have lived in for at least two years as of the award application date. Applicants must be registered full-time in a University pre-apprentice trades program. Applicants must demonstrate financial need. Complete the Student Financial Award Application Form. Provide the length of time you have lived in as of the award application date. Indicate whether you have attended a high school and the duration of attendance. Submit the application by September 30, 2026.
